Job Title:                  Safety Trainer

Location:                  El Reno Campus

Reports To:              Asst. Director – Workforce & Economic Development Division

FLSA Status:            Exempt

Benefits:                    Employee Health, Dental, Vision and Life Insurance; Sick, Personal,Vacation, Community Service Leave; Paid Teacher Retirement; $3600 Flex Benefit Allowance; 401a Employer Match; $2000 Employee Tuition Assistance Reimbursement

Job Group:               BH

_______________________________________________________________________

 

Summary

The Safety Instructor will provide hands-on and classroom-style educational courses and programs to Workforce & Economic Development (WED) clients on a variety of safety-related topics. Must be able to work flexible hours. Must be able to work and conduct classes in a variety of school and industrial settings.

 

Education and Experience
Bachelor’s Degree in related field of study or minimum of 5 years’ experience working in safety as an instructor, or in a position of similar duties and knowledge; minimum high school diploma or equivalent. A minimum of 3-5 years’ experience working in safety or related field required. Must be certified or able to become certified to teach OSHA 10 & 30. Preference may be given for ability to communicate in Spanish.

 

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following. To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. Other duties may be assigned.

  • Provide instruction of safety-related educational courses and programs to students and clients in the following areas:
    • Safeland USA and H2S
    • Forklifts, Aerial lifts, Telehandler, and Scissor Lifts
    • First Aid/AED/CPR (Red Cross, American Heart, Medic 1st Aid)
    • Confined Space
    • Fall Protection
    • Fire Extinguisher
    • OSHA 10 & 30, General & Construction
    • Respiratory Protection/Fit Testing
    • Bloodborne Pathogens
    • Present other courses and programs as needed and where qualified;

 

  • Maintain current certifications;
  • Receive direction and respond promptly to queries from district workforce development coordinators who are scheduling training opportunities;
  • Maintain equipment;
  • Keep calendar listing of commitments up to date;
  • Complete all paperwork and data entry for each class

 Professional Development

  • Willing to attend professional development meetings
  • Willing to obtain additional job-related certifications on an ongoing basis
  • Stay current on OSHA regulations and ODOL safety reporting requirements 

Work Environment

The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. The primary work environment is in an office/classroom environment that regularly requires employee to sit, stand and/or walk for extended periods of time. Requires reliable, dependable and punctual attendance. The employee must occasionally lift and/or move up to 40 pounds. The employee may be around loud machinery, chemical and/or equipment.
